1

我正在研究涉及多目標調度問題的論文項目的可能研究主題,我想知道是否有人有將圖像表示爲這樣的問題的想法。我查看了一些關於這個主題的文獻,並且一種常見的方法似乎是在邊緣使用成本向量而不是單個成本數字。這對我來說很有意義,但我不明白我如何通過這種方式對我的問題的某些方面進行建模。多目標問題的圖形表示

特別是模型中有資源將每個活動限制在特定的時間窗口內,而有效的時間表必須安排這些限制內的每個活動。此外,還有一些相互依賴的活動。例如,用戶可以在兩個活動之間放置時間增量要求,說明它們必須在彼此的若干個時間單位內進行安排,或者必須至少在有效時間安排中隔開一定數量的時間單位。我可以想象將這些作爲可選元素建模成本矢量,但有沒有更好的方法?

獎金的問題是,這也應該是一個最少的承諾調度。每個活動都應該有一個名義上有n個單位長的窗口,因此不一定是活動的總訂單。

任何關於表達這樣的問題的文獻將不勝感激!

回答

0

這裏有一個關鍵字爲您搜索:約束編程

可以作爲所謂的約束滿足問題,即一組變量,它們的可能值這樣的問題模型和組約束你的解決方案(=選擇變量的值)必須滿足。

通過CP,您可以將上面的文本直接表達爲單個約束(f.ex.,活動A必須在活動B變得像A.endTime < = B.startTime之前)。

至於文獻,有許多關於CP可用的書籍和論文,特別是關注調度(甚至有專門針對調度問題的CP的會議)。